Artifact signing — FixtureForge test-data factory. All published FixtureForge packages must carry a valid signature or the Brindlewood registry rejects them. Support: if a customer reports an install failure citing signature mismatch, confirm they're on the current key, not last quarter's. Verification steps are on the sibling page. The current signing key for FixtureForge releases is the following.

release key, hafog-fahop: bky19_zkTP7ab9CVAiKT51aeq

Q: What do I do if the Greystone telemetry gateway rejects my admin login after a config push? A: This usually means the gateway rolled back to its failsafe profile, which invalidates cached credentials. Do not factory-reset the unit, as field sensor pairings will be lost. Instead, open the local recovery console and enter the recovery passphrase below.

unlock words, hahip-baduf: holwyn-istath-julvan

Subject: SDK parity status — Lanternwire clients

Hi all — quick note for those new to the team. The Lanternwire Kotlin and Swift SDKs are now at full feature parity as of this week's cut; streaming retries were the last gap. Parity checks run nightly. This announcement corresponds to the build token below.

session token of tajog-fahaf = htk21_4ae55819f45410afcb307

Planning note for finance, re: the Brindlewood franchise agreement. Terms are mostly settled — five-year initial run, standard royalty tiers, and Harrow & Felce handling the territory carve-outs. We'll book setup fees in Q2 and start royalty accruals the quarter after. Nothing scary in the drafts so far. One confidential point on our expansion plans is noted just below.

board note of fahif-yahog: Gross margin on Wenath came in at 10 percent against a plan of 5 percent. Only 3 of the 100 pilot accounts renewed Wenath, so a churn review is set for July 15.